Struct ratchet_rs::UpgradedServer [−][src]
pub struct UpgradedServer<S, E> {
pub request: Request<()>,
pub websocket: WebSocket<S, E>,
pub subprotocol: Option<String>,
}
Expand description
A structure representing an upgraded WebSocket session and an optional subprotocol that was negotiated during the upgrade.
Fields
request: Request<()>
The original request that the peer sent.
websocket: WebSocket<S, E>
The WebSocket connection.
subprotocol: Option<String>
An optional subprotocol that was negotiated during the upgrade.
Implementations
Consume self and take the websocket